Understanding Thalassemia Trait and Dietary Needs
Thalassemia trait, also known as thalassemia minor, is a genetic condition where an individual carries one gene for thalassemia but does not have the full-blown disease. While many people with the trait are asymptomatic, some may experience mild anemia. The primary dietary concern is managing iron, as the body can sometimes absorb or retain more iron than needed, leading to potential iron overload, even without blood transfusions.
A proper diet focuses on three main areas: limiting highly-absorbable iron, ensuring adequate intake of supporting nutrients like folic acid and calcium, and using natural iron absorption inhibitors. It is crucial to remember that this approach differs from that for iron-deficiency anemia, where increasing iron intake is necessary.
Foods to Include in Your Thalassemia Trait Diet
Eating a varied diet rich in plant-based foods, healthy fats, and specific nutrients is beneficial for managing thalassemia trait.
Folic Acid and B-Vitamins
Folic acid (vitamin B9) is vital for producing healthy red blood cells, which can be limited in those with thalassemia trait.
- Legumes: Lentils, chickpeas, black beans, and peas are excellent sources of folic acid and other B-vitamins.
- Leafy Greens: Certain greens like romaine lettuce and turnip greens provide folate. However, use caution with spinach and other high-iron greens.
- Fortified Grains: Many bread, pasta, and cereal products are fortified with folic acid, as mandated in some countries.
- Fruits: Bananas, oranges, and strawberries are good sources of B-vitamins.
Calcium and Vitamin D
Some people with thalassemia are at higher risk for weakened bones (osteoporosis), making adequate calcium and vitamin D intake important.
- Dairy Products: Milk, cheese, and yogurt are traditional sources of calcium that can also help inhibit iron absorption when consumed with meals.
- Fortified Alternatives: For those who are lactose intolerant, fortified soy milk and other dairy alternatives are excellent sources of both calcium and vitamin D.
- Vegetables: Broccoli and kale provide calcium.
- Vitamin D: Besides fortified foods, sunlight is the main source of vitamin D.
Proteins and General Nutrition
- Plant-Based Proteins: Tofu, beans, lentils, and nuts are good protein options that contain non-heme iron, which is less readily absorbed than heme iron.
- White Meat and Poultry: Chicken and turkey offer a source of protein with lower levels of heme iron than red meat.
Foods to Limit or Avoid with Thalassemia Trait
Excessive iron intake can be detrimental. It's not about cutting out all iron but about being mindful of particularly high-iron and iron-fortified foods, especially those containing easily absorbed heme iron.
High-Heme-Iron Foods
- Red Meat: Beef and pork contain high levels of heme iron and should be limited.
- Organ Meats: Liver is extremely high in iron and should be avoided.
- Seafood: Some fish and shellfish, like oysters, are also rich in heme iron.
Iron-Fortified and Other High-Iron Foods
- Fortified Cereals: Many common cereals are fortified with iron. Always check the label and opt for alternatives if necessary.
- Iron Supplements: Unless specifically prescribed by a doctor, do not take iron supplements.
- Cooking in Cast Iron: Iron can transfer from the cookware to your food, increasing your intake.
Managing Enhancers and Inhibitors
- Vitamin C: This vitamin boosts iron absorption, so it's advisable to separate intake of vitamin C-rich foods (citrus fruits, bell peppers, tomatoes) from iron-rich meals.
- Alcohol: Excessive alcohol consumption should be avoided as it can facilitate oxidative damage from excess iron.
